SNIF® PHD-50
The SNIF® PHD-50 is a portable, rotary injector system designed to treat molten aluminium in-process furnaces. The PHD-50 with tilting head can be equipped to perform bi-gas metal treatment or solid refining agent injection. The spinning rotor head can be moved or tilted from vertical to horizontal positions allowing for angled operation in tight spaces. This mobile system can be easily relocated from station to station. The submerged propeller design promotes uniform mixing and circulation of the melt.

SNIF® HD-2000
The SNIF® HD-2000 provides automated metal processing in furnaces and a safe, efficient alternative to the manual use of flux wands.
Featuring an integrated degassing impeller, the SNIF HD-2000 offers the flexibility to simultaneously circulate and treat the melt. The SNIF HD-2000 injects treatment gas or solid refining agent below the metal surface to effectively reduce alkali metal content and improve inclusion removal efficiency.
The SNIF HD-2000 can be either floor mounted beside the furnace or mounted on the side wall of the furnace. In the standby position, the mixing shaft and impeller are completely removed from the furnace. For operation, the mixing shaft and impeller pivot into position. The impeller is completely submerged in the molten aluminium, maximizing the mixing action, while providing efficient degassing for metal cleaning.

SNIF® P-Cartridge Lining
The SNIF® P-Cartridge is a refractory furnace lining that is easily replaced. When the furnace refractory needs to be changed, the spent cartridge is lifted by using a specially designed spreader bar and a crane. After the used P-Cartridge is removed, a new lining can be installed within a few hours.
